XmlTextReader.LookupNamespace(String) Método

Definição

Resolve um prefixo de namespace no âmbito do elemento atual.

public:
 override System::String ^ LookupNamespace(System::String ^ prefix);
public override string? LookupNamespace(string prefix);
public override string LookupNamespace(string prefix);
override this.LookupNamespace : string -> string
Public Overrides Function LookupNamespace (prefix As String) As String

Parâmetros

prefix
String

O prefixo cujo URI de namespace queres resolver. Para corresponder ao namespace padrão, passa uma string vazia. Esta corda não precisa de ser atomizada.

Devoluções

O URI do espaço de nomes para onde o prefixo corresponde ou null , se não for encontrado prefixo correspondente.

Exceções

A Namespaces propriedade é definida para true e o prefix valor é null.

Observações

Note

Recomendamos que crie instâncias XmlReader usando o método XmlReader.Create para aproveitar a nova funcionalidade.

No XML seguinte, se o leitor estiver posicionado no href atributo, o prefixo a é resolvido chamando reader.LookupNamespace("a"). A cadeia devolvida é urn:456.

<root xmlns:a="urn:456">
 <item>
 <ref href="a:b"/>
 </item>
</root>

Aplica-se a

Ver também